Pachinko by Min Jin Lee
5.0
okay WOW I'm so so glad that I didn't let the size of this book deter me from finally picking it up.
I'm pretty sure I went through every single emotion known to man while reading this book. After finishing it, I promptly bought my own copy. A good book makes me want to know more and more about what I maybe missed or didn't initially understand right away, and I know that that is what I'll be doing for the next few days. I thought I knew enough about Japanese and Korean relations, but this opened up my eyes to so much more that I ignorantly didn't know about Japanese occupation, as well as the horrors of war and what impact that has on generations of people afterwards. The way women were treated back then, as well as what a strong hold family and culture has on people and society?!? PHEWWW. please read this if you haven't!

Lovesickness: Junji Ito Story Collection by Junji Ito
4.0
4 stars!!
A much overdue read and excitedly fun palette cleanser of a horror manga.
Junji Ito's art never fails to make me stare at the page for at least a few minutes before moving on, the art in this, particularly in the first story in this collection is unreal.
I quickly got into the first half of this book with the story of the town and the crossroads fortunes. The other half of the book is a collection of other interesting short stories. (The one with the family actually cracked me up). One of my other favorites, The Rib Woman, is included in this collection also!
